The expenses associated with replacing a BMW key can depend upon a number of aspects, including the model year of your car, the kind of key required, and the approach of replacement. Below is a table summarising the typical costs for different types of keys and replacement techniques.
Key TypeReplacement Cost (Approx.)NotesBasic Key₤ 150 - ₤ 300Least costly option for older models.Remote Key₤ 200 - ₤ 400Consists of programming expenses; varies by model.Smart Key₤ 300 - ₤ 600Most pricey; includes sophisticated innovation for keyless systems.Key Fob Battery Replacement₤ 10 - ₤ 20Expenses for replacing the battery in a key fob instead of the entire key.Elements Affecting the Cost
Numerous factors can affect the rate you pay for a Replacement BMW Car Keys Replacement Key [crane.waemok.co.kr]:
Model and Year of the Vehicle: Newer BMWs often have higher replacement expenses due to the advanced technology included.
Key Type: As noted in the table above, different key types have various expenses, with wise keys usually being the most pricey.
Dealership vs. Locksmith: Getting a replacement key from a BMW dealer is typically more expensive than going to an independent locksmith with BMW-specific understanding, although the latter might not have access to all the required tools or programming capabilities.
Location: Prices vary throughout the UK, with metropolitan locations tending to have higher costs compared to backwoods.
Alternatives to the Dealership
If you are trying to find cost-efficient alternatives to getting a replacement key from a dealer, consider these choices:
Local Locksmiths: Many locksmiths can configure and cut BMW keys at a lower price than a dealer. Ensure they have experience with BMW keys particularly.
Keyless Entry Kits: For older BMW models, aftermarket keyless entry packages might be a choice. These can be installed for a fraction of the cost of a new key.
Online Retailers: Some online platforms offer blank keys that can be cut and configured. Be cautious, as this may not constantly deal with newer designs.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: How long does it take to replace a BMW key?
A1: The time it takes to replace a BMW key can vary however usually ranges from 30 minutes to a few hours. If you go to a dealership, it might take longer due to programming and security checks.
Q2: Can I program a BMW key myself?
A2: Programming a BMW key typically needs unique equipment and know-how. It's typically best to leave it to a professional locksmith or dealer.
Q3: What do I need to bring when replacing my BMW key?
A3: You will normally need to provide car identification (VIN), proof of ownership (like the vehicle registration), and a kind of ID.
Q4: Is my BMW key covered under guarantee?
A4: Replacement keys are typically not covered under basic guarantees. However, specific coverage may exist if you have an extended warranty that includes key replacement.
